Senior Accounting Manager A PE-backed global SaaS company is entering a critical phase of growth and integration following a major acquisition.

Responsibilities

~1 min read
  • Lead accounting oversight for US entities, with a strong focus on close quality, balance sheet accuracy, reconciliations, and local reporting support.
  • Build practical processes that improve statutory compliance, audit readiness, documentation standards, and overall finance discipline.
  • Partner closely with international finance leaders to align US accounting activity with broader reporting timelines, policies, and business priorities.
  • Evaluate the current state of sales tax and nexus obligations, then help shape a more scalable approach with advisors and automation support.
  • Contribute to finance transformation initiatives, including ERP-related process improvement and stronger reporting workflows.
  • Act as a trusted finance resource for US stakeholders by bringing responsiveness, sound judgment, and a business-minded perspective.
  • Help strengthen a function that is moving from highly manual, people-dependent processes toward a more structured and scalable operating model.
  • Serve as a key finance leader helping build the long-term US finance infrastructure for a rapidly growing organization.
  • Strong experience in US GAAP, financial reporting, and controllership-oriented accounting work.
  • Ability to support audits and work confidently with external partners and advisors.
  • Background in SaaS, software, or other recurring revenue environments is strongly preferred.
  • Exposure to ERP implementations, systems improvement, or finance transformation work.
  • Working knowledge of US sales tax, nexus, or indirect tax compliance.
  • CPA strongly preferred, though other relevant accounting credentials may be considered.
  • Comfort operating independently in a high-ownership individual contributor role.
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to collaborate effectively with finance leadership based in Europe.
